Expanding Horizons in Air Cargo Fleet
The aviation cargo world is witnessing a tangible shift as Air One International fortifies its fleet with the arrival of a second Boeing 777F aircraft. This addition, managed through its affiliate, One Air, exemplifies a strategic move to expand the airline’s capacity on long-haul routes.
Key Details on the New Boeing 777F
The newly delivered Boeing 777F was handed over at Boeing’s Everett production facility in the United States before flying to its new base at East Midlands Airport in the UK. Scheduled to operate services to Hong Kong, this powerful freighter enhances the airline’s ability to meet growing demand on this critical cargo corridor.

Why East Midlands Airport?
East Midlands Airport serves as a pivotal hub for cargo logistics in the UK, offering extensive freight handling facilities, modern infrastructure, and excellent connections to road and rail networks. Its strategic location makes it ideal for managing international shipments and optimized distribution across Europe and beyond.

The Boeing 777F: A Workhorse in Air Freight
Known for its impressive fuel efficiency, long range, and cargo capacity, the Boeing 777F stands out among freighter aircraft. It offers airlines the ability to transport large volumes of freight non-stop over transcontinental distances, crucial for just-in-time delivery models and reducing handling delays.
